What is the difference between intelligence and emotional intelligence?

Intelligence refers to cognitive abilities such as problem-solving and reasoning skills, while emotional intelligence relates to the understanding and management of emotions in oneself and others. Emotional intelligence involves skills like empathy, self-awareness, and relationship management, which are crucial for effective social interactions and leadership.


What is the different between IQ and EQ?

IQ, or Intelligence Quotient, measures cognitive intelligence related to logical reasoning and problem-solving abilities. EQ, or Emotional Quotient, measures emotional intelligence related to self-awareness, empathy, and social skills. While IQ indicates intellectual capacity, EQ reflects one's ability to navigate and manage emotions in oneself and others.

What is the difference between adolescence and maturity?

Adolescence is the stage of development between childhood and adulthood, characterized by physical, emotional, and cognitive changes. Maturity, on the other hand, refers to being fully developed and grown, both physically and emotionally. Adolescents are typically still learning and growing, while maturity implies a level of stability and wisdom gained through life experiences.

What is the difference between learning style and dominant intelligence?

Learning style refers to the way an individual prefers to learn best, such as through visual, auditory, or kinesthetic methods. Dominant intelligence refers to a person's strongest cognitive abilities, as theorized by Howard Gardner's multiple intelligence theory, which includes areas like logical-mathematical, linguistic, and interpersonal intelligences. In summary, learning style is about preferred learning methods, while dominant intelligence is about inherent cognitive strengths.
